Sadananda Mohanty And Others v. State Of Odisha

2022-06-29Mr. Justice Biraja Prasanna Satapathy2 pages

IN THE HIGH COURT OF ORISSA AT CUTTACK

W.P.(C)(OAC) No.1598 of 2015 Sadananda Mohanty & Ors.

....

Petitioners -versusState of Odisha & Ors.

....

Opposite Parties

CORAM:

JUSTICE BIRAJA PRASANNA SATAPATHY

ORDER

29.06.2022

02. 1. This matter is taken up through Hybrid Arrangement Order No (Virtual/Physical) Mode.

2. Heard learned counsel for the Petitioners and learned counsel for the Opposite Parties.

3. The Petitioners have filed the present Writ Petition with the following prayer:- " In view of the facts mentioned in para-6 above, the applicants pray for the following relief(s):- a) Set aside the orders dtd.10/10.2014, 29/11/2013 and 25/11/2014 at Annexure-7 series & 8 respectively being ultravires to Arts.14 and 16 of the Constitution of India. b) Declare that the applicants are deemed to be continuing in old OCS (Pension) Rules, 1192 and entitled to all the benefits under the said old OCS (Pension) Rules, 1992 and G.P.F. (Odisha) Rules, 1938.

c) Issue any other order/direction which would offered complete relief to the applicants, in the facts & circumstances of the case."

4. Considering the submission made and without expressing any opinion on the merits of the case, the Petitioners are directed to

// 2 // make individual representations before the Opp. Party No.3 by enclosing all the relevant documents and citations in support of their claim, if any, within a period of three (3) weeks hence.

5. It is observed that if such representations are filed within the aforesaid period, the Opp. Party No.3 shall do well to take a lawful decision within a period of three (3) months from the date of receipt of such representations. The order so passed by the Opp. Party No.3 be communicated to the Petitioner.

6.

With the aforesaid observations and directions, the Writ Petition is disposed of.
